How Much Does a Destination Wedding Band Cost in 2025?

In 2025, the average cost of hiring a destination wedding band is around £8,950.

This typically includes the band’s performance fee as well as travel and accommodation, but prices can vary widely depending on several factors, most importantly where your wedding takes place and how large the band is.

Smaller acoustic duos or trios for relaxed ceremonies or cocktail receptions often start from £2,000–£4,000.

A mid-sized 4–6 piece party band will usually cost between £5,000 and £8,000, while a large international showband (8–12 performers) with brass, multiple vocalists and dancers can range from £9,000 to £15,000+, once travel, accommodation and production are included.

Several key factors influence the final quote:

Destination and distance: travel logistics and hotel costs are usually the biggest contributors.
Band size: more musicians mean more flights, baggage and accommodation.
Equipment hire: hiring a PA system and lighting locally can cost anywhere from €250 to €2,000 depending on location.
Performance length: full-day coverage or late finishes can add extra fees.
Season and demand: summer Saturdays in destinations like Italy, Spain and France are peak dates.

Should I hire a local band or an international destination wedding band from the UK for my wedding?

The answer to this question will vary according to a few factors. Probably the first consideration is your budget: flying a band from the UK to your destination wedding is rarely a cheap thing to do. The biggest expenses (apart from the band’s performance fee itself of course) are usually the cost of flights and equipment hire locally. Secondly, whether you need to fly in a band from overseas will also depend on local talent available. There are many great bands based in countries across Europe – unfortunately not all of them have the best online presence, which can make it difficult to discover them when trying to organise your wedding from another country. FixTheMusic has curated a growing selection of local bands, DJs and musicians in countries such as France, Spain, Italy, Greece and Cyprus. So you might want to check out the local talent as well as international bands. That said, if you're after a band that does a specialist genre of music (e.g. UK garage or lots of R&B, for example), then you will probably need to rely on a destination wedding band, as most local musicians won't specialise to such an extent and will cater to more general music tastes. How do bands quote for destination weddings overseas?

When it comes to the band providing you with their price, there are usually two ways they do this: some prefer to provide a quote for just their performance fee and then require the client to cover all of their expenses. Other bands are willing to provide the client with an all-inclusive quote, which includes their accommodation and travel expenses. Usually the cost of hiring a PA system and any other equipment is not included as it can be quite time-consuming to obtain quotes from local suppliers for this and the prices can vary widely between suppliers. What expenses do wedding bands normally need to be covered for them when performing abroad?

Some bands prefer not to provide all-inclusive quotes; instead, they quote for just their performance fee and request the client to pay for all of their additional expenses. These usually include flights from their nearest airport (with some baggage allowance for instruments), transfers in the destination country (e.g. taxis), accommodation, food and drinks, and PA system / equipment hire.

What are the pitfalls to avoid when hiring a band for a destination wedding?

Probably the most frequent issue couples encounter when trying to hire a destination wedding band is finding reasonably priced suppliers to hire a PA / sound system and equipment from. In the past couple of years, we’ve seen prices for hiring a basic PA system range from €250 to €2,000. Often your wedding planner can help put you in touch with trusted local suppliers, or feel free to get in touch with us – we’re always happy to help hunt for the best equipment hire companies. Another dilemma couples often face is whether to arrange for the band to arrive the day before the wedding or on the day of the wedding itself. Many bands will charge an extra fee to arrive the day before – as it means they can’t accept any other work or gigs the night before. But it can be risky having the band arrive on the morning of the wedding as it doesn’t leave much time for flight delays or other disruptions to the band’s journey.

How can I get the most out of a band when hiring them for my destination wedding?

If you’ve booked a UK band for your destination wedding, many will offer to perform for other parts of your wedding day at a heavily reduced rate, e.g. during the ceremony or some background musical entertainment at your drinks reception. Although most UK weddings tend to finish by midnight, weddings on the continent usually go on until the small hours. Bands experienced at performing for destination weddings will know this already and be ready to extend their usual timings until 1am or 2am (though some may charge extra for this or timings later this).
